BOSTU members have voted to accept the revised NHS pay offer in England. In the consultation of all members working in the NHS in England, 577 members cast a vote, a turnout of 60%, with 80% voting to accept and 20% voting to reject.  The offer covers two pay years – an additional one-off amount for 2022/23 and a 5% wage rise (10.4% for the lowest paid) for 2023/24. Retirement calculator (Scottish members) A retirement calculator that helps people understand the pension implications of the McCloud ruling is now live for 12 different pension schemes, the Government Actuary’s Department (GAD) has announced. Plans for the calculator were first announced in 2022 in response to the 2018 McCloud ruling, which found that changes to the public sector pensions were discriminatory on the grounds of age. The judgement meant that some public sector pension scheme members have the choice between two different types of benefits: legacy schemes or reformed schemes. Ongoing disputes make it impossible to submit evidence to NHS pay review body, say health unions. Health unions won’t be submitting joint evidence to the NHS pay review body for the next wage round while the current industrial disputes remain unresolved, it has been announced today (Wednesday). Instead, BOSTU have joined with 13 other unions – representing more than one million ambulance staff, nurses, porters, healthcare assistants, physiotherapists and other NHS workers in England – to call for direct pay talks with ministers. BIOS and BOS TU have released the following definition of professional leadership: British and Irish Orthoptic Society definition of professional leadership Professional leadership for an orthoptist or orthoptists can only be provided by an orthoptist. Unlike clinical leadership or operational management, professional leadership requires in-depth knowledge of the profession and a link to the relevant professional body. A professional leader will have an understanding of the strategy of both the employing organisation and the relevant professional body, and have the freedom and autonomy to ensure the staff they lead work in a way which complies with both. The PRB has recommended that every NHS pay point should increase by £1,400. This announcement covers all NHS staff groups other than doctors. The PRB have also recommended that staff in Band 6 and 7 should get 4% instead of £1,400, where this is higher. The government has accepted those recommendations. This means once again the PRB process and the government’s decisions have left NHS staff with another real-terms pay cut.
